I found this very beautiful park and spent 4 happy hours yesterday. It was too short time so I'll go back one day. It's a huge park and NO Trash! The cleanest place in Bangkok. Tickets 20 B locals, 50 farang. I don't like double pricing but in this case I don't mind paying 'cause it's so nice place. "Suan Luang Rama IX (Thai: สวนหลวง ร.9, pronounced [sǔan lǔaŋ rɔ̄ː kâːw], RTGS: Suan Luang Ro Kao), also referred to as (King) Rama IX Park, is a public park in Bangkok's Prawet District. With an area of 500 rai (80 ha; 200 acres), it is the largest park in the city." https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Suan_Luang_Rama_IX https://www.google.com/search?client=firefox-b-d&q=suan+luang+park+bangkok

I was looking for this kind of easy trip. No need to leave the van: "Arrived at the Cambodia border (Ban Pakkad) at 09:54. Departed Thailand at border control, then handed passport to the driver. In the meantime, we waited at passport control until the driver arrived back with our passports, which now had the necessary Cambodia visa inside and entry and exit stamps in and out of Cambodia. All we were required to do now was to re-enter Thailand." I don't list the company 'cause don't no if allowed?
